Mongolia's meteorology agency predicts colder, wetter winter, urging public preparedness.
Mongolia's National Agency for Meteorology and Environmental Monitoring forecasts a colder than average winter ahead, especially in the eastern regions, with increased precipitation. The agency urges public preparedness, particularly for nomadic herders. Last winter's extreme conditions, known as dzud, resulted in over 10% of the livestock population, approximately 7.95 million animals, dying due to severe cold and snow-covered ground.
